Julien Kirch

Posté le 12/09/2016 par Julien Kirch

Cela n’est pas seulement changer une configuration de à : c’est de la gouvernance, du planning et du budgetOn parle de quoiL’essentiel des discussions sur les services porte sur les questions de design et de technique. Sur ces deux axes, on commence maintenant à disposer de pratiques bien établies. Cet article ne traitera donc pas de ces aspects....

Lire la suite >

Posté le 27/06/2016 par Vitor Monteiro Puente, Julien Kirch, Oliver Baillot

Nesta série de artigos, discutimos o que são microservices, as suas vantagens e limitações. Caso você ainda não tenha lido os artigos anteriores, basta ir até a Parte 01 e Parte 02.Neste último artigo, de uma série de três, vamos discutir se precisamos mesmo de microservices. Também iremos discutir como dar início a uma implementação ou restruturaç...

Lire la suite >

Posté le 20/06/2016 par Vitor Monteiro Puente, Julien Kirch, Oliver Baillot

Na parte 01 deste artigo discutimos a arquitetura baseada em microservices. Foram apresentados os problemas encontrados em grandes projetos sob a perspectiva da complexidade e da inovação. Também foi apresentado o conceito de microservices e como microservices trata as dificuldades encontradas em grandes projetos.Na parte 02, iremos tratar as vanta...

Lire la suite >

Posté le 13/06/2016 par Vitor Monteiro Puente, Julien Kirch, Oliver Baillot

Em 2015, houve um grande barulho sobre o tópico de microservices. Não havia uma conferência sequer que não falasse no assunto e não houve uma semana sem um novo mágico framework que fosse capaz de entregar mil funcionalidades com um clique.Resultado: houve muito foco em ferramentas e histórias bonitas, e não em questões realmente relevantes.Logo, n...

Lire la suite >

Posté le 03/12/2015 par Julien Kirch, Oliver Baillot

In 2015, a peak in microservices was reached: there is no conference without a Netflix engineer to sell you a dream, not a week without new magic framework to do it all without asking any question.Result: a focus on the tools and beautiful stories rather than substantive issues.It therefore seemed useful to us to review the architectural aspects of...

Lire la suite >

Posté le 12/10/2015 par Julien Kirch

En 2015, le pic des microservices a été atteint : pas une conférence sans un ingénieur de Netflix pour vous vendre du rêve, pas une semaine sans nouveau framework magique pour tout faire sans se poser de question.Résultat : une focalisation sur les outils et les belles histoires plutôt que sur les questions de fond.Il nous a donc semblé utile de fa...

Lire la suite >

Posté le 03/09/2015 par Julien Kirch

Avec l’arrivée de REST, on est tenté d’oublier tout ce qu’on faisait avant car c’était forcément moins bien. Mais, si les technologies ont changé, les bonnes pratiques SOA sont toujours aussi pertinentes, et permettent de mettre en œuvre des services qui répondent aux besoins tout en gardant la maîtrise de son système d’information.Avec la mise en ...

Lire la suite >

Posté le 01/06/2015 par Erwan Alliaume, Cédrick Lunven, Julien Kirch

Having written about monitoring flow and best practices for setting it up, let's move onto a practical example. We'll define a mini-information system combining services and messages, then we will show how to monitor it, including technical explanation and the full code.The application components presented in this article have generic names (fronte...

Lire la suite >

Posté le 14/04/2015 par Cédrick Lunven, Julien Kirch

Après avoir décrit le monitoring de flux et les bonnes pratiques pour le mettre en place, passons à un cas pratique. Nous allons détailler un exemple complet et documenté de monitoring d’un mini-système d’information combinant appels de services et envois de messages, avec des modèles de code.Les composants applicatifs présentés dans cet article on...

Lire la suite >

Posté le 11/02/2014 par Julien Kirch

Le code de vos projets n'est jamais parfait et se détériore avec le temps. C'est un problème important car, s'il est mal maîtrisé, vos temps de développement seront plus longs et vos bugs plus fréquents.Le concept de dette techniqueLa définition de Wikipedia est éclairante:Il s'inspire du concept existant de dette dans le contexte du financement de...

Lire la suite >